Jane Marie Lynch is an American actress, comedian, and singer. Lynch is known for starring as Sue Sylvester in the musical comedy series Glee (2009–2015), which earned her a Primetime Emmy Award. Lynch also gained recognition for her roles in Christopher Guest’s mockumentary films, such as Best in Show (2000), A Mighty Wind (2003), and For Your Consideration (2006). By Alys DaviesBBC News Getty ImagesPro-choice activists marching in Miami, Florida on 24 JuneFlorida's Republican Governor Ron DeSantis has signed a bill banning most abortions after six weeks, paving the way for drastic changes in access to the procedure across the state. Opponents argue six weeks is before many women know they are pregnant. The law will not go into effect until a court rules on an ongoing legal challenge to the existing 15-week ban.
Gianni Minà was a journalist, writer, magazine editor, and television host from Italy. He worked with both Italian and international newspapers and magazines; produced hundreds of reports for RAI (Radiotelevisione Italiana); created and hosted television programs; and produced successful documentary films about Che Guevara, Muhammad Ali, Fidel Castro, Rigoberta Mench, Silvia Baraldini, Subcomandante Marcos, and Diego Maradona. Mina was born on May 17, 1938, and sadly died on March 27, 2023.

Explore More A protester was in critical condition Friday after setting themself on fire outside the Israeli consulate in Atlanta, authorities said. A security guard who tried to intervene was also injured. A Palestinian flag found at the scene was part of the protest, Atlanta Police Chief Darin Schierbaum said at a news conference. He added that investigators did not believe there was any connection to terrorism and none of the consular staff was ever in danger.
